MHK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

530 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mohawk Industries (MHK)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$11.5B — up 0.75% from $11.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 90 funds opened new MHK positions and 63 closed out — a net gain of 27 holders — while 202 added to existing stakes and 173 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Suvretta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$65.3M. The largest seller was Lone Pine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$236M sold.
